Tento článek je zrcadlovým článkem o strojovém překladu, klikněte zde pro přechod na původní článek.

Pohled: 12933|Odpověď: 0

[C] Použijte název pole jako argument funkce Opačné pořadí pole

[Kopírovat odkaz]
Zveřejněno 10.12.2015 17:17:11 | | |
//数组a中n个整数按相反的顺序存放
Použijte funkci INV k její implementaci, skutečný parametr používá název pole a a parametr shape může také používat název pole nebo proměnnou ukazatele

#include "stdafx.h"
#include "stdio.h"
int main(int argc, char* argv[])
{void inv(int x[],int n); inv funkce
int i,a[10]={3,7,9,11,0,6,7,5,4,2};
printf("původní pole:\n");
for(i=0; i<10; i++)
printf("%d,",a[i]);
printf ("\n");
inv(a,10);
printf ("pole bylo invertováno:\n");
for(i=0; i<10; i++)
printf("%d,",a[i]);
printf ("\n");
return 0;
}
void inv(int x[],int n)
{int temp,i,j,m=(n-1)/2;
for(i=0; i<=m; i++)
    {j=n-1-i;
     temp=x[i]; x[i]=x[j]; x[j]=temp;
    }
návrat;
}






Předchozí:Ukazatelové proměnné jako parametry funkce Porovnejte velikost
Další:RSA generuje veřejné i soukromé klíče, stejně jako šifrování a dešifrování
Zřeknutí se:
Veškerý software, programovací materiály nebo články publikované organizací Code Farmer Network slouží pouze k učení a výzkumu; Výše uvedený obsah nesmí být používán pro komerční ani nelegální účely, jinak nesou všechny důsledky uživatelé. Informace na tomto webu pocházejí z internetu a spory o autorská práva s tímto webem nesouvisí. Musíte výše uvedený obsah ze svého počítače zcela smazat do 24 hodin od stažení. Pokud se vám program líbí, podporujte prosím originální software, kupte si registraci a získejte lepší skutečné služby. Pokud dojde k jakémukoli porušení, kontaktujte nás prosím e-mailem.

Mail To:help@itsvse.com